About

Maresfield ward encompasses a mix of woodland, farmland, and residential settlements within the High Weald. The area includes the village of Maresfield itself, along with Nutley and parts of Ashdown Forest. Land use is primarily rural, with a network of small roads connecting scattered properties and farms.

The landscape is characterised by its underlying sandstone geology, which supports extensive pine plantations and heathland. A notable local feature is the presence of several historic hammer ponds, remnants of the Wealden iron industry that once operated here. The ward maintains a quiet, semi-rural character distinct from the larger towns in the district.

Area overview

On average Maresfield has moderate de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 54 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 7.6%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Maresfield is £69,380 per year. There are 2 schools in Maresfield: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Maresfield is home to around 3,659 people, with a population density of about 139.2 per km2.

Property prices in Maresfield

Based on 33 recent sales, the median property price is £602,000 in Maresfield area, with individual transactions ranging from £187,500 up to £1,450,000.
